Agreed - oil additives like STP or the like are used to make seals swell.Cavalier342 wrote:Depends on how bad the leak is, if the gasket or seal at fault is nackered bad enough, no additive will help there.
So only help with minor leaks.
Tears or serious leaks will need a seal replacement.
I suppose it depends on which Corsa you have, as to how difficult it will be to get the box off.
Corsa-B and C won't be too bad,
But Corsa-D and E will be a nightmare due to the amount of wiring and sensors and other ancillaries that need to be moved or unplugged to make enough space to get to the drive shafts, selector linkage and the bell-housing bolts.
In the case of a later Corsa, I would get the clutch components replaced too whilst the box is off.
It makes sense to try the cheaper fluid additive fix first, and cross your fingers that it is enough to stop or reduce the leak.

more than likey wont stop leaking until the seal is replaced.
be sure that the oil level is never over filled as this is the certain cause for failure.
make sure the the crankcase ventilation system isn't blocked
